The back taxes are the FICA taxes which must be paid on ALL household employees who work more than a certain number of hours per month, even if their parents came over on the Mayflower. The employee needs a social security number so the employer can pay the taxes. The discussion should focus at least as much on the fact that this would-be Labor Secretary would have been breaking an important labor law by not paying those taxes even if the employee was eligible to work in the US. So “I didn’t know she was undocumented, and when I found out I made it right” does not get him off the hook.
